What is domain and its examples?
When referring to an Internet address or name, a domain or domain name is the location of a website. ... For example, the domain name "google.com" points to the IP address "216.58. 216.164". Generally, it's easier to remember a name rather than a long string of numbers.

How do I find the domain of a website?
Use ICANN Lookup The Internet Corporation for Assigned Names and Numbers (ICANN) is a non-profit organization that collects domain information. Use the ICANN Lookup tool to find your domain host. Go to lookup.icann.org. In the search field, enter your domain name and click Lookup.

What is the difference between a domain and a website?
A domain is the name of a website, a URL is how to find a website, and a website is what people see and interact with when they get there. In other words, when you buy a domain, you have purchased the name for your site, but you still need to build the website itself.
Can I host a website without a domain name?
Some web hosts, mainly free web hosts, allow you to create a website even if you don't have a domain name. ... For example, if your web host is "example.com" (not a real web host), they may create a subdomain called "chris.example.com" which you can use for your website.

How do you write a domain?
We can write the domain and range in interval notation, which uses values within brackets to describe a set of numbers. In interval notation, we use a square bracket [ when the set includes the endpoint and a parenthesis ( to indicate that the endpoint is either not included or the interval is unbounded.

What does having a domain mean?
- A domain name is the Internet equivalent of a physical home address for a website. The name, such as "mywebsite.com" or "internetaddress.org" points to an exact location to a server, much like a postal address points to an exact apartment in a building.
What does domains mean?
- Domain(n.) (Computers) an address within the internet computer network, which may be a single computer, a network of computers, or one of a number of accounts on a multiuser computer. The domain specifies the location (host computer) to which communications on the internet are directed.
